Last year, I had the large pleasance of attending the Games Industry Conference (GIC) successful Poznań, Wielkopolska, wherever I sat successful connected a fig of talks astir crippled improvement and craft. In 1 of those talks, fixed by Petr Nohejl, devops programmer for Warhorse Studios, I heard a fascinating anecdote that got maine reasoning astir the silliness of video games, and the lengths testers spell to successful bid to guarantee they tally smoothly for players.
Nohejl’s speech was astir Kingdom Come: Deliverance II and the challenges faced by programmers trying to debug the game, resoluteness crashes, and woody with gameplay hitches. It was acold deeper and much precocious than the spot I’m presenting here, and admittedly beauteous implicit my caput successful presumption of method specifics, arsenic I’m not a crippled developer myself. But astatine 1 point, helium was talking astir mounting up simple, repeatable scenarios in-game that tin beryllium tested automatically, and gave the pursuing example:
There are immoderate trial rotations, truthful you conscionable spawn the player, you wait, you arsenic I mentioned…and past the subordinate rotates a fewer times. So it conscionable loads up each the stuff, the streams. And we person these random rotations each astir the maps. So the rotation trial conscionable similar teleports and performs the rotation connected thousands and thousands of places connected the map. And past we person really a vigor representation of the full rotation test.Essentially, Nohejl is describing what I americium told is simply a prime assurance trial wherever the subordinate is spawned in, they rotation astir a fewer times successful place, and that’s it. I americium told by respective individuals I spoke to with QA acquisition and expertise that this is simply a precise communal trial and, to astir QA professionals, astir apt beauteous boring. But to me, who’d ne'er considered the granular specifics of what went into investigating games, it was hilarious.
In the aftermath of this discovery, I enactment retired a telephone connected societal media and done assorted PR contacts for QA professionals to stock their astir ridiculous crippled investigating stories: essentially, what’s the silliest happening they’ve had to bash to trial thing successful a game? What came backmost was a delightful flood of anecdotes ranging crossed AAA blockbusters to tiny indies, canvassing a decennary oregon much of crippled development. I americium present thrilled to stock these stories with you successful hopes that you find the goofy incidentals of QA investigating arsenic comic arsenic I do.
Shootin’ the Breeze
“While investigating Unreal II for Xbox, if we angled our weapon upwards by 45 degrees and changeable the battle firearm astatine the span strut arsenic we walked crossed it, the crippled would consistently crash. We tested that anserine span for weeks.” -Ben Kosmina
“When I was connected Overwatch I had to trial to marque definite that the materials connected the assorted surfaces were acceptable up decently for deed effects. For example, erstwhile shooting wood it would dependable similar wood was being impacted alternatively of metal. There are a LOT of materials and surfaces successful the assorted levels, but I had entree to the exertion tools truthful I really made a investigating leader to assistance marque things easier. It was fundamentally Widowmaker with a 1s cooldown connected her hookshot, Hanzo's partition ascent ability, and an expanded mag size truthful I could sprout much freely. I besides gave myself similar 10x question velocity and the quality to toggle the slug sounds connected and disconnected truthful I could perceive the impacts better. Then I proceeded to methodically tally astir each representation shooting each unsocial worldly aboveground to marque definite they were making the close noises. When I moved disconnected the squad I was chatting with 1 of my friends and helium was saying helium inactive utilized that leader for testing, which made my day.” -Andrew Buczacki
“[On] Anno 2070, I had to bash a bid of tests and videos for the USK standing board. Spent respective days dropping nukes implicit and over, zooming successful to the small radical showing that it wasnt graphic. Had a full video & Images folder of a parent with a babe buggy no-selling a nonstop nuke astatine antithetic angles.” -Ruairí Rodinson, Rho Labyrinths workplace head
Inventing a Guy
“Hello! The full communicative is simply a spot much complicated. The NPC successful Mental Refreshment [in The Outer Worlds 2] was really my 1st brushwood with a peeing NPC and I thought that, for immoderate reason, the invisible collision is the intended behaviour displayed by a urinating NPC. Then, immoderate days later, I saw an NPC performing an unfamiliar animation.
“I curiously walked up to him and, to my large surprise, helium was peeing! At that infinitesimal the disorder started. ‘Why does the crippled fto maine get truthful adjacent to him?’ ‘I couldn't adjacent imagination of coming this adjacent to the different peeing NPC!’ And so, the probe has begun.
“After bothering a fewer different guiltless pissing NPCs it turned retired that my cardinal presumption that NPCs are expected to beryllium shielded portion relieving themselves was wrong! I dutifully reported the excessive collision connected the mentally refreshed taxable and present the User tin peacefully ticker him bash his concern from up close.” -Aleksander Gozdzicki, FQA Tester, QLOC, The Outer Worlds 2
“So I was a programmer alternatively than QA, but I retrieve having to get originative erstwhile I was investigating immoderate of my codification connected Kinect. I had immoderate codification that was meant to observe idiosyncratic making aerial guitar motions, and I had to shove my hoodie up my T-shirt successful bid to cheque that it would enactment with large people.
“When investigating the 'new user' Kinect login series we had to deterioration carnival masks to halt it from recognizing us.” -Tim Aidley
“On Saints Row we had a debug npc named Skinballs (lol) that was virtually conscionable 4 spheres wrapped successful antithetic shades of tegument texture truthful we could trial lighting for antithetic tegument tones during development…teams request to program for that benignant of investigating with intentionality, and not capable do.” -Elizabeth Zelle
“My favourite illustration of this was ‘The Carwash’ connected Mortal Kombat (X? 11?) wherever a T-posed quality would dilatory determination done a bid of particle emitters, each 1 causing a circumstantial benignant of harm - cuts, stabs, burns, gashes, ice, etc. truthful we could trial harm models connected characters.” -Daanish Syed, erstwhile Netherrealm Artist
“We utilized placeholder characters earlier successful Sunderfolk’s improvement whilst quality creation was inactive pending. One successful peculiar was a escaped quality exemplary from Adobe’s Mixamo tract called ‘Brute’ which was fundamentally a ample oily barbarian. He was regularly utilized to capable successful the committee and for cinematics to spot however animations look and function. Affectionately named Oily Man, we inactive usage him in-engine for leader spawn indicators successful the brushwood designer. Oily Man lives on!” -Ali Tirmizi, Sunderfolk QA Lead astatine Secret Door
WoW!
Andrew Buczacki graciously supplied maine with a fig of anecdotes from his clip connected World of Warcraft, which I’ve included each arsenic 1 chunk for the WoW fans successful the room:
“When investigating the last brag of the Icecrown raid successful Wrath of the Lich King, we had a bug wherever Frostmourne (the Lich King's sword) didn't look successful cinematic connected a circumstantial hardware configuration. They mobilized the full QA level for WoW to trial each permutation of graphics setting, resolution, etc. to spot if it was happening anyplace else. By the extremity of the investigating time we had each watched the cinematic (and seen astir of the raid fight), to the constituent wherever galore of america had memorized the monologues and the cinematic. You'd randomly perceive "Bolvar!" for months after.
“Also connected that fight, I was assigned a hotfix wherever 1 of the AoEs the brag did was expected to grow 15% faster. There were nary bully precise measuring tools truthful my person and I acceptable up a ridiculous investigating contraption involving engineering fume flares, a huntsman pet, and wide usage of in-game cheats. At the extremity we were capable to verify that it was astatine slightest expanding faster, though I reason we got a grade of precision that astir apt wasn't indispensable by the end.
“Old clip WoW fans whitethorn retrieve that implicit the people of a fewer patches the shoulderpads connected immoderate race/gender combos (male Orcs astir notably) shrunk. This was yet caught and fixed, but to marque definite it didn't hap again 1 of the tests my squad ran was to look astatine a fixed assemblage of quality models wearing assorted instrumentality connected the existent mentation and the newest build. We had an automated publication that would log successful and instrumentality pictures from fixed angles and equip the aforesaid things truthful we could comparison screenshots to marque definite that everything stayed the aforesaid size.
“Once I had to trial and verify that the ‘Win a loot rotation with a 100’ accomplishment was working. To bash this I went to Onyxia's Lair (a fashionable sandbox for QA), and aft not winning the lottery and winning loot with a 100 connected Onyxia I spawned successful astir 100 raid bosses astatine erstwhile with deity mode on. Then I utilized ace almighty AoE cheat spells to termination them each and began the laborious process of looting and rolling connected each of them. The accomplishment wholly worked, by the way.”
CAN you favored the dog?
“So here's thing that I'm beauteous definite astir radical don't ever deliberation about: Testing "Can you Pet the dog?" successful games. Like, it's a diagnostic a batch of radical look for and adore successful video games, but I don't deliberation your each time mean idiosyncratic realizes that, arsenic cute arsenic it is, it took radical HOURS upon HOURS to get it close haha. So successful Demonschool for instance, erstwhile you favored the dog, you'll get unsocial dialog per interaction. The canine tin besides beryllium recovered connected antithetic maps and depending connected the day and however galore times you've favored him, helium mightiness determination to antithetic locations. If you beryllium determination and fto Faye favored the dog, the camera volition (very) dilatory zoom successful to springiness the subordinate a amended presumption of it.
“At 1 constituent successful development, we came to find retired of that 1 of the random softlocks we were encountering was really tied to the adorable, lovable enactment of petting the dog. This meant that we had to walk HOURS investigating each imaginable adaptable of petting the dog. Every determination it showed up in, each dialog drawstring attached to it, each day it was disposable to pet. We'd skip petting it definite days and successful definite locations to effort to premix up wherever it appeared successful the crippled connected antithetic dates to spot if THAT was causing the issue. We had to marque definite that the dilatory camera zoom was moving connected each and each representation that the canine tin look on, and each VERSION of those maps (day, evening, and night).
“So what yet should beryllium a fun, cute small easter ovum that beauteous overmuch each random subordinate enjoys seeing successful a game, ended up becoming hours and hours of enactment down the scenes to marque definite it worked conscionable close and wouldn't softlock the crippled for everyone haha. And aft tons of hours and hundreds of pets, we tin present each happily favored the canine without issue!” -AJ McGucken, pb QA astatine Ysbryd Games
Make Some Noise
“One clip erstwhile I was doing audio for deity of war, we had enactment a dependable of a frog croaking connected the frog asset. Well, 1 of the level designers took that frog and COVERED an land successful them. So I had to marque a JIRA summons to termination frog island.” -Shayna Moon, elder method producer
“Off the apical of my head, I recovered a bug moving connected New Super Mario for Wii that was astatine the commencement screen. The crippled shows the rubric and plays a small song. At the extremity of the song, it transitions to "demo" footage of Mario &co jumping around. If you property start, you are taken to the starting menus (new game, load game, options etc) IN THEORY, but if you hap to property commencement astatine the EXACT infinitesimal betwixt the 2 states of the commencement screen, the crippled alternatively hard locks and indispensable beryllium force-restarted.
“So, each time we got a caller build, I had to regress this bug by sitting astatine the commencement surface and trying to property commencement astatine precisely the close moment. If it didn't lock, I had to backmost retired and effort again. It was highly tedious and hard to get right, proving a negative. Another tester was a small amended astatine the timing than maine truthful we would bash this unneurotic each morning, conscionable pushing start, for hours, similar the world's worst bushed game.” -Anonymous
In summation to each the anecdotes I received for this piece, I besides conducted an interrogation with Camden Stoddard, audio manager astatine Double Fine moving connected Keeper. Stoddard chatted with maine astir the analyzable process helium went done to get Twig, the bird, to dependable precisely right, which included a batch of unusual investigating practices.
The affectional enslaved betwixt Twig and the Lighthouse successful Keeper was captious to the game, truthful Stoddard spent a batch of clip investigating antithetic things to get the connection betwixt the 2 conscionable right. He tried existent vertebrate sounds and recordings and libraries. He tried utilizing a foghorn with the Lighthouse, "which nary substance what you do, a foghorn doesn't get that emotional," helium said. So helium muted the Lighthouse, which worked retired better, but determination was inactive the substance of the bird, Twig. I'll fto Stoddard instrumentality it from here:
"I wasn't reaching it with the recordings of birds. So I conscionable started studying however a vertebrate talks, and it turns retired their larynx is unsocial successful nature. They person two. They person an avian larynx wherever they person a little 1 called a syrinx. And basically, that means that their transportation power and their signifier power is ridiculous. They tin conscionable bash things that astir animals cannot with their voice.
"So I started reasoning astir that. I'm like, 'Well, okay, this vertebrate is mode beyond the affectional code of an existent bird. So we request a quality show here. So however bash I marque a quality dependable similar a bird?' So I conscionable started fooling astir with my ain voice, and I coiled up uncovering this bundle that was meant for physics music. It was from an physics radical successful Europe.
"And I had utilized it before, but what was absorbing astir it is simply a batch of things you tin adjust, transportation and things similar that, but this, you could set the harmonics trail. That was what was interesting. And arsenic soon arsenic I enactment my dependable done it and I started messing astir with it, I became a bird. My dependable conscionable started sounding similar a bird, which made a batch of sense.
"So I started experimenting with, I would bash the show arsenic the bird. I started studying however birds communicate, and past I started reasoning about, "Okay. Well, if I tin person the dependable of the bird, but I tin person the affectional punctuation and signifier that we privation emotionally, past I deliberation we got it nailed." So implicit astir 2 years, I yet got however to bash Twig. And the hard portion connected maine was, the champion mode to bash Twig was to inhale portion I was doing the dependable and not exhale, due to the fact that erstwhile you inhale, your larynx becomes overmuch much earthy and benignant of nonhuman-sounding. So if I inhale, you're like... You get this brainsick scope that you're not utilized to. And erstwhile I manipulated that, that's wherever Twig came from.
"So past each of a sudden, I became similar an actor, and I had to fig retired these heavy, dense scenes, which I hadn't counted on, due to the fact that it's a precise affectional game. There's immoderate heights of choler and sadness and astonishment and existent existentialism successful the end. It's wild. So I not lone had to spell to the limits of my dependable plan know-how, I had to fig retired however to marque this vertebrate precise affectional and truly attraction astir this lighthouse."
Below is simply a signaling shared with america by Stoddard showing the three-step translation of his dependable from his ain vertebrate sounds to the last sounds utilized successful the game. It uses a Granelli SM57 dynamic microphone going done an Avalon 737sp preamp, and assorted bundle to edit it, including a combo of Eventide 910 and 949 harmonizers (software) and Manipulator by Polyverse (software). It was each recorded successful Pro Tools.
Climb Every Mountain, Drop Every Weapon
"When moving connected the Mr. X Nightmare DLC for Streets of Rage 4, the squad noticed that sometimes, erstwhile a subordinate dropped their weapon, it would autumn done the floor. We had to driblet each the weapons to place the issue, which turned retired to beryllium circumstantial to a azygous weapon... the swordfish! Perhaps it's a caller benignant of flying fish?" -Laura Peitavi, pb elder QA, Streets of Rage 4 DLC.
"In NINJA GAIDEN: Ragebound, the subordinate quality (Kenji) tin ascent up walls. However, erstwhile attempting to drawback a partition with a tiny surface, helium would often presume an unnatural presumption wherever it appears that helium is supporting his full assemblage value with a azygous arm. The level designers astatine The Game Kitchen could acceptable an "is climbable" spot for each partition successful the Unity crippled engine, but determination was nary mode to acceptable this spot to mendacious automatically for each abbreviated partition recovered successful the game. Therefore, Dotemu's full QA squad had to effort to drawback each azygous partition successful the crippled successful bid to find which ones could pb to animation issues truthful that The Game Kitchen could change the properties of the problematic walls." -James Petit, QA expert - Ninja Gaiden Ragebound
A Castle Made of WHAT
“Back successful 2022, good earlier we announced Wildgate, ‘Banana Castle’ was the nickname we gave to this illustration task that we sent to outer vendors truthful they could assistance america place show bottlenecks successful our physics simulation, without revealing what we were really moving on. Using banal Unreal assets, we glued these models unneurotic to trial our in-game physics.” - Grant Mark, Wildgate method manager astatine Moonshot
“I had a trial level [in The Outer Worlds 2] that was a operation wherever each country was a antithetic carnal material, which meant that immoderate of the rooms had walls/ceilings/floors made wholly of hairsbreadth oregon skin.
“Different ‘physical materials’ volition person antithetic sound/visual effects depending connected the material. For example, if you occurrence a slug astatine a factual floor, the decal (a slug hole), the interaction VFX (sparks flying oregon whatever) and the dependable effects volition beryllium antithetic than if you had fired astatine the crushed connected a sandy beach. Footsteps besides marque antithetic sounds erstwhile walking astir connected these antithetic materials. In summation to things similar factual and sand, we besides person carnal materials for hairsbreadth and tegument (so that they tin person the due effect to being changeable astatine oregon whatever).
“If I wanted to rapidly verify that these effects were moving correctly it was utile to beryllium capable to load into this trial level, teleport to the country with the carnal worldly I was looking for, and past I could trial for each of these material-specific features by shooting the walls and walking astir connected the floors and such.” -Josh Ledford, QA analyst, Obsidian for The Outer Worlds 2
Rebekah Valentine is simply a elder newsman for IGN. Got a communicative tip? Send it to [email protected].

hace 1 semana
11









English (CA) ·
English (US) ·
Spanish (MX) ·
French (CA) ·